July 24, 2007, Introduced by Rep. Opsommer and referred to the Committee on Transportation.
A bill to amend 1949 PA 300, entitled
"Michigan vehicle code,"
(MCL 257.1 to 257.923) by adding section 307c.
TH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F MICHIGAN ENACT:
Sec. 307c. (1) Any license issued under this act that
authorizes the licensee to operate a motor vehicle, or any
supplement issued in conjunction with any of those licenses, shall
not contain either of the following:
(a) A radio frequency identification device.
(b) Any other device capable of having stored information read
by a remote receiver, if the device and remote receiver can share
information when they do not have a clear line of sight between
them.
(2) As used in this section, "radio frequency identification
device" means an electronic device that stores information and is
designed to transmit that information by means of radio waves to a
receiver.
